library(UCSCXenaTools)
data(XenaData)

head(XenaData)

## -----------------------------------------------------------------------------
# The options in XenaFilter function support Regular Expression
XenaGenerate(subset = XenaHostNames=="tcgaHub") %>% 
  XenaFilter(filterDatasets = "clinical") %>% 
  XenaFilter(filterDatasets = "LUAD|LUSC|LUNG") -> df_todo

df_todo

## -----------------------------------------------------------------------------
x1 = XenaScan(pattern = 'Blood')
x2 = XenaScan(pattern = 'LUNG', ignore.case = FALSE)

x1 %>%
    XenaGenerate()
x2 %>%
    XenaGenerate()

## ---- eval=FALSE--------------------------------------------------------------
#  XenaQuery(df_todo) %>%
#    XenaDownload() -> xe_download

## -----------------------------------------------------------------------------
options(use_hiplot = TRUE)

XenaQuery(df_todo) %>%
  XenaDownload() -> xe_download

## -----------------------------------------------------------------------------
cli = XenaPrepare(xe_download)
class(cli)
names(cli)
